全面解析Shadowsocks管理界面(DMS)的使用与配置

在当今信息化社会,网络安全与隐私保护变得越来越重要。Shadowsocks作为一种广泛使用的科学上网工具,受到了很多用户的青睐。为了更好地管理Shadowsocks,*DMS(Dashboard Management System)*应运而生。本文将深入探讨Shadowsocks管理界面DMS的功能、配置以及常见问题。

什么是Shadowsocks DMS?

DMS是指Shadowsocks的管理界面,用于监控、配置和管理Shadowsocks的服务器和客户端。它为用户提供了一个友好的操作界面,帮助用户快速掌握网络流量的使用情况、连接状态等信息。

DMS的主要功能

  • 监控连接状态:DMS可以实时监控所有连接到服务器的客户端状态。
  • 流量统计:DMS能够统计每个客户端的流量使用情况,便于用户管理。
  • 配置管理:用户可以通过DMS对Shadowsocks的各种配置进行管理与修改。
  • 日志记录:DMS会记录用户的连接日志,便于后续的排查和分析。

DMS的安装与配置

1. 安装DMS

首先,确保你的服务器上已经安装了Shadowsocks。接下来,按照以下步骤安装DMS:

  • 登录到你的服务器,打开终端。

  • 使用命令安装DMS: bash
    git clone https://github.com/shadowsocks/dms.git
    cd dms
    npm install

  • 配置DMS,编辑配置文件config.json,根据你的需求设置各项参数。

2. 配置Shadowsocks

在DMS的配置文件中,你需要添加Shadowsocks服务器的信息:

  • 服务器地址:填写你的Shadowsocks服务器地址。
  • 端口号:填写对应的端口号。
  • 加密方式:选择合适的加密方式,例如AES-256-GCM
  • 密码:设置连接的密码。

3. 启动DMS

配置完成后,可以启动DMS: bash npm start

访问http://你的服务器IP:端口,即可打开DMS管理界面。

使用Shadowsocks DMS

1. 监控连接

在DMS的首页,你可以看到当前连接到你的Shadowsocks服务器的所有客户端。通过实时监控,可以有效管理并控制连接数量,避免超负荷运行。

2. 流量管理

DMS提供了详细的流量统计功能,用户可以查看每个客户端的流量使用情况,以便根据需要进行限制或调整。

3. 配置更改

通过DMS,用户可以随时对Shadowsocks的配置进行更改,无需重新启动服务。只需在DMS的配置页面进行修改并保存即可。

4. 日志查看

DMS的日志功能能够帮助用户追踪连接情况,及时发现并解决问题。

Shadowsocks DMS常见问题解答

Q1: DMS如何确保安全性?

DMS会通过加密措施来保护数据传输过程中的信息,确保用户的连接安全。

Q2: 如何查看DMS的使用日志?

可以在DMS的管理界面中,选择“日志”选项,查看所有连接的详细信息,包括时间、IP地址、流量等。

Q3: 如果无法连接到DMS,应该怎么办?

  • 检查服务器是否正常运行。
  • 确认网络设置无误。
  • 确保端口没有被防火墙阻挡。

Q4: DMS支持哪些加密算法?

DMS支持多种加密算法,包括AES-256-GCMChaCha20等,用户可以根据需求进行选择。

Q5: DMS可以管理多个Shadowsocks服务器吗?

是的,DMS支持同时管理多个Shadowsocks服务器,用户只需在配置文件中添加相应的服务器信息即可。

结论

Shadowsocks DMS为用户提供了一个便捷的管理工具,使得对Shadowsocks的使用与管理更加高效。通过本文的指导,相信读者能更好地理解和使用Shadowsocks DMS,提升网络安全性与使用体验。

正文完